The Technology
Dynamic Imaging. Definitive Diagnosis.
Digital Motion X-ray (DMX) is a fluoroscopic imaging technology that captures real-time motion of the cervical and lumbar spine. Unlike static X-ray or MRI, DMX records the spine under physiological load — exposing instability, ligament laxity, and abnormal motion patterns that are invisible at rest.
- Captures 30 frames per second of spinal motion under load
- Identifies ligament damage invisible to static imaging
- Provides objective, measurable documentation of instability
- Accepted in clinical and legal proceedings as evidentiary imaging
- Non-invasive with radiation dose comparable to standard X-ray
